
As part of the effort to support vulnerable students during COVID-19 pandemic, Human Development Initiatives provided vulnerable students under her Tertiary Education Trust Fund scheme with food items and a token. This intervention took place at the HDI office on the 30th of June, 2020. 22 students were impacted through the intervention. In compliance to the Government’s COVID-19 guidelines, the students went through temperature check, washed their hands and observed physical distancing.
The beneficiaries were admonished to be fervent in prayer, considering the times we are in (COVID-19), and also encouraged to acquire new skills and add value to themselves.
They were urged to be mindful of the company they keep and reach out to the Organization, if they have any challenge.
At the end of the program, the beneficiaries appreciated the organization for her continuous support towards their education, the financial aid and palliatives given to them.
